All organisms face a constant barrage of environmental stresses. Single-cell organisms such as Saccharomyces cerevisiae, or common Baker’s yeast, must rely solely on cellular responses in order to survive. This response must occur in a rapid and highly coordinated manner to quickly inhibit all unnecessary processes and shuttle all available resources to those necessary for survival. One method that cells utilize for rapid protein regulation is the use of post-translational modifications. It is well known that arginine vasotocin (AVT) in birds is involved in physiological homeostasis such as cardiovascular, osmotic regulation as well as reproductive functions. Pertinent to these physiological functions, AVT immunoreactive (-ir) neurons in the hypothalamus have been found associated with hemorrhage, dehydration, oviposition and other physiological regulation. Evidence, however, suggests that AVT also plays significant roles in modulating behavior, memory, stress, and food intake. This dissertation research addresses the latter two neuroendocrine functions of AVT in detail within the chicken brain. The present study investigated the distribution of the vasotocin subtype four receptor (VT4R) in brain and pituitary gland of the chicken, Gallus gallus. The anterior pituitary cell types associated with the VT4R were also determined. Two polyclonal antibodies were raised in rabbit against a cocktail of peptides, 15 amino acids from the amino terminal region and 17 amino acids from the carboxy terminal region of VT4R receptor. The antibody was validated utilizing the Western blot and immunocytochemistry.
